A shoe store uses a 60% markup for all the shoes it sells. What would be the selling price of a pair of shoes that has a wholesa
le cost of $53? (Round to the nearest cent as needed.)
1 answer:
Answer:
Selling price = $84.80
Step-by-step explanation:
Multiply the cost by 1 + the mark up percentage.
53 x 1.60 = 84.80
Selling price = $84.80
